Backcountry.com pickup??
Is there anyway I could pick something up from backcountry? Seems idiotic to order stuff in UT, have it shipped (quickly) to MD, then promptly put it in a bag and board a plane to UT.
Unless of course backcountry stuff ships from all over the place. Just wondering, is all...

They have a retail shop on site - you can buy anything there. They literally radio people in the warehouse and bring the items up front. Also I was told that if you place an order and immediately contact them you can specify an on-site pickup (but i would double check that prior to ordering).

Yes, I've done it several times.
Call them after placing your order and request on-site pick up rather than delivery. They will credit your account for the shipping. It also helps if you have your order number readily available.
Maybe Backcountry has a radio button to select pick up rather than shipping, but SAC doesn't.
